Tendua Vailan
Tendua Vailan is a village located in Hanumana tehsil of Rewa district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Hanumana (tehsildar office) and 92km away from district headquarter Rewa. As per 2009 stats, Tendua Belan is the gram panchayat of Tendua Vailan village.

About Tendua Vailan
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tendua Vailan is 466237. The village spans a total geographical area of 178.73 hectares. Hanumana is nearest town to Tendua Vailan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

Population of Tendua Vailan
According to the 2011 Census, Tendua Vailan has a total population of about 1,135, with approximately 594 males and 541 females. The sex ratio is around 910 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 171 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 44 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 411. The overall literacy rate is approximately 49.25%, with male literacy at about 55.56% and female literacy near 42.33%. There are around 281 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,135 | 594 | 541 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 171 | 93 | 78 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 44 | 25 | 19 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 411 | 206 | 205 |
Literate Population | 559 | 330 | 229 |
Illiterate Population | 576 | 264 | 312 |
Connectivity of Tendua Vailan
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tendua Vailan. As per the 2011 stats, Tendua Vailan had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available |
